The zero-rate eco-loan, or eco-PTZ

Beyond this aid, the good reflex is to use the zero-rate eco-loan (eco-PTZ), which is not subject to income conditions. It can finance a wide range of workin the main residence only, within the limit of a loan of 30,000 euros on a package of work, or 50,000 euros for a complete renovation.

“The work must be carried out by a craftsman with the Recognized Guarantor of the Environment (RGE) label and, since 1er January, an overall renovation project must be validated by a support person from the France Renov public service.declares Fabienne Amblard-Larolphie, director of the individual market at Caisse d’épargne, a bank which granted 13,500 eco-PTZs in 2023.

What if eco-PTZ is not enough to cover the overall bill? You can ask your bank for a work loan, the rest being your responsibility. Most establishments have set up consumer loan offers specially designed to finance energy renovation, at rates between 3.50% and 4%, for amounts of up to 50,000 euros, or even 75 000 euros.

They are often very flexible: both owners and tenants are eligible, for their primary or secondary residence. “The subscription process is simpler than for an eco-PTZ, the customer can even finance work that would not be eligible for the regulated loan, for example single-glazed windows »specifies Mme Amblard-Larolphie.

Another avenue to explore: BNP Paribas has just signed a partnership with EDF to support its customers in their energy renovation. All agencies in the network will offer the IZI by EDF platform by the end of the year, which allows work to be estimated and then carried out, and financed.

“Financial aid to which the client is eligible, such as MaPrimRénov’, will be deducted from the estimate, only the balance is subject to a loan at an advantageous rate ranging from 0% to 2.82% depending on the project”, explains Nicolas Draux, director of personal clients at BNP Paribas France. The loan is granted by Domofinance, a subsidiary of BNP Paribas Personal Finance and EDF specializing in financing energy renovation work. This structure is open to everyone, including non-clients of the bank. It finances, in particular, the work loans offered by EDF to its customers at subsidized rates.
